Understanding the Risks of Online Dating for Seniors

One of the primary concerns for seniors using dating sites is the potential for scams and fraudulent activities. Unfortunately, older adults are often targeted by scammers who exploit their vulnerabilities. These scams can range from financial fraud to catfishing, where someone creates a fake profile to deceive others. It’s crucial for seniors to be aware of these risks and to educate themselves on how to identify red flags, such as overly flattering messages or requests for money.

Another risk involves privacy and data security. Many dating sites require users to share personal information, including their location, interests, and even financial details. Seniors must ensure that they are using reputable platforms that prioritize user safety and data protection. Reading reviews and understanding the site’s privacy policies can help mitigate these risks.

Challenges in Establishing Connections

Beyond safety concerns, seniors may face challenges in forming genuine connections online. The digital landscape can be overwhelming, especially for those who did not grow up with technology. Navigating dating apps and websites may feel daunting, leading to frustration and discouragement. Additionally, the communication styles of younger generations often differ from those of older adults, which can create misunderstandings or misinterpretations in conversations.

Moreover, seniors may find it challenging to meet like-minded individuals who share their interests and values. While many dating sites cater to specific demographics, the sheer volume of users can make it difficult to find a compatible match. This can lead to feelings of isolation or disappointment, especially if expectations are not met.

Tips for Safe Online Dating

Despite the risks and challenges, online dating can be a rewarding experience for seniors if approached with caution. Here are some tips to enhance safety and improve the chances of successful connections:

  • Choose Reputable Sites: Opt for well-known dating platforms that have positive reviews and a strong reputation for safety.
  • Protect Personal Information: Avoid sharing sensitive details, such as your home address or financial information, until you have established trust with someone.
  • Communicate Cautiously: Start with messaging on the platform before moving to phone calls or video chats. This allows you to gauge the other person’s intentions.
  • Meet in Public: When you decide to meet in person, choose a public place and inform a friend or family member about your plans.
  • Trust Your Instincts: If something feels off, don’t hesitate to end communication. Your safety and comfort should always come first.
